US Special Representative for Trade; Dilawar Syed stressed the importance of cooperation between Morocco and Nigeria as part of a partnership in Washington on Friday to ensure a successful African energy transition. He pointed out that it is a partnership between the two great countries of the region.

“Coordination and cooperation on the energy transition is a good thing,” he add in a statement to “MAP “on the sidelines of a conference hosted by the US Trade Council Nigeria on the role of Nigeria and Morocco in regional cooperation on the future of the energy sector.

“We will continue to encourage everyone to adopt renewable energy,” he added. “It’s good for the planet and good for the African continent,” Dilawar claimed

Also, the US officials highlighted the long-term potential that the renewable energy sector offers the African continent and the promising prospects that hydrocarbon development offers Morocco.
